>Americans could soon be slicing into a steak that has never seen the inside of a cow. Plant-based meat company Beyond Meat has launched its latest attempt to win over carnivores with a new 'Beyond Steak Filet' that looks, cooks and is even designed to 'bleed' like a traditional beef steak. The unusual product is now making its grocery store debut, arriving on shelves at Wegmans on the East Coast and H-E-B stores in Texas after previously only being available through select restaurants and the company's own website. The move marks one of the biggest bets yet that shoppers are finally ready to swap conventional beef for an ultra-realistic plant-based alternative. Wegmans says it is the only East Coast brick-and-mortar retailer carrying the product this year, selling a pack containing two 4.45-ounce filets for $10.99.
